基于BIST的FPGA内部延时故障测试方法:原理、应用与优化.docxVIP

  • 0
  • 0
  • 约2.8万字
  • 约 31页
  • 2026-02-05 发布于上海
  • 举报

基于BIST的FPGA内部延时故障测试方法:原理、应用与优化.docx

基于BIST的FPGA内部延时故障测试方法:原理、应用与优化

一、引言

1.1FPGA概述与应用现状

在现代数字系统的发展进程中,FPGA(现场可编程门阵列)凭借其独特的优势,已然成为了关键的组成部分,发挥着举足轻重的作用。FPGA是一种基于可配置逻辑块(CLBs)、可编程输入/输出块(IOBs)以及灵活互连资源构成的半导体设备。其核心优势在于高度的灵活性与可重构性,这一特性使得设计人员能够依据具体的需求,通过编程对芯片进行配置,进而实现特定的逻辑功能。这就好比为数字系统搭建了一个“万能积木”平台,工程师可以根据不同的应用场景,自由地组合这些“积木”,构建出满足各种需求的电路系统。

随着技术的飞速发展,FPGA在诸多领域得到了极为广泛的应用。在通信与网络领域,它是各类通信和网络设备不可或缺的关键部件,如路由器、交换机、光纤通信设备等。在5G通信时代,FPGA在5G基站信号处理中扮演着核心角色,用于实现5G信号的物理层处理,包括复杂的调制和解调操作,以及波束成形技术的实现,极大地提高了信号的覆盖范围和传输质量,增强了5G基站的通信性能。在数字信号处理领域,FPGA凭借其强大的并行处理能力,成为实现高性能数字信号处理的理想选择,被广泛应用于音频处理、视频编解码、雷达信号处理、图像处理等多个方面。在汽车与航天领域,随着汽车电子化和智能化的发展,以及航天事业对高可靠性和稳定性设备的需求,FPGA在汽车电子系统和航天器中的应用愈发广泛,如用于车载娱乐系统、发动机控制单元、自动驾驶系统、卫星导航、遥感系统等。在工业自动化领域,FPGA同样发挥着重要作用,可用于控制系统、机器人控制、自动检测和调试等任务,有效提高了工业自动化水平。在高性能计算领域,FPGA能够加速各种计算密集型任务,在科学计算、密码学、人工智能等领域发挥着重要作用,比如在人工智能领域,它可以加速神经网络的训练和推理过程,提高人工智能系统的性能。在智能物联网领域,FPGA被用于实现感知、数据处理、通信和安全等功能,广泛应用于智能家居、智能城市、智能农业等场景。

1.2FPGA内部延时故障的影响与挑战

尽管FPGA在数字系统中具有广泛应用和重要价值,然而,其内部延时故障问题却不容忽视,给系统的性能和稳定性带来了诸多严峻挑战。内部延时故障是指信号在FPGA内部逻辑单元和互连资源中传输时,由于各种因素导致的延迟时间超出了正常范围,从而引发的故障。

这种故障对FPGA性能和系统稳定性的影响是多方面的。从性能角度来看,它可能导致数据处理速度下降,无法满足系统对实时性的要求。在一些对数据处理速度要求极高的应用场景中,如高速数据采集与处理系统、实时图像识别系统等,哪怕是微小的延时故障都可能导致数据丢失或处理错误,进而严重影响系统的整体性能。以高速数据采集与处理系统为例,若FPGA内部存在延时故障,在高速数据采集过程中,可能会出现数据采样不准确或数据传输延迟的情况,使得后续的数据处理无法基于准确的数据进行,最终导致处理结果出现偏差,无法满足实际应用的需求。

从系统稳定性角度分析,内部延时故障可能引发逻辑错误,使系统出现异常行为甚至崩溃。在复杂的数字系统中,各个逻辑单元之间紧密协作,通过精确的时序控制来保证系统的正常运行。一旦出现延时故障,就可能打破原有的时序平衡,导致信号在错误的时间到达,从而引发逻辑混乱,使系统无法按照预期的功能运行。在航空航天领域的飞行控制系统中,FPGA作为关键组件用于实现飞行控制律的硬件计算,若FPGA内部发生延时故障,可能导致飞行控制指令的计算和传输出现延迟或错误,进而影响飞机的姿态控制,严重威胁飞行安全。

传统的主要测试技术,如功能测试和电气测试,往往难以有效地检测出FPGA内部延时故障。功能测试主要是验证系统是否能够实现预定的功能,而电气测试则侧重于检测电气参数是否符合标准。然而,内部延时故障具有一定的隐蔽性,它可能不会直接导致系统功能的完全丧失或电气参数的明显异常,只是在特定的条件下才会表现出故障症状,因此传统测试技术很难发现这类故障。这就迫切需要一种专门针对FPGA内部延时故障的测试方法,以确保FPGA的可靠性和系统的稳定运行。

1.3基于BIST的测试方法的重要性

在应对FPGA内部延时故障测试的挑战中,基于BIST(内建自测试)的测试方法展现出了至关重要的作用和显著的优势,成为解决这一问题的关键技术手段。BIST技术是一种在FPGA内部集成的故障检测技术,它通过在FPGA内部生成和应用测试信号,能够实现对其内部逻辑和存储器功能的自我检测。

BIST技术最大的优势之一在于它极大地减少了对外部测试设备的依赖。在传统的测试方法中,往往需要借助昂贵且复杂的

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档